About Pratik Kumar
Pratik Kumar is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Molecular Biology, Materials Chemistry, Cell Biology and Spectroscopy, having authored 16 papers that have together received 422 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Click Chemistry and Applications (8 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(8 papers), Photochromic and Fluorescence Chemistry (4 papers), Advanced Fluorescence Microscopy Techniques (2 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(2 papers), Biotin and Related Studies (2 papers),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(1 paper) and Protein Degradation and Inhibitors (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Organic Chemistry (312 citations), Structural Biology (13 citations), Microbiology (50 citations), Environmental Chemistry (53 citations) and Biophysics (24 citations). Pratik Kumar has collaborated with scholars based in United States, India and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Jiaul Hoque, Jayanta Haldar, Scott T. Laughlin, Divakara S. S. M. Uppu, Venkateswarlu Yarlagadda, Padma Akkapeddi, Ting Jiang, Vinod K. Aswal, Wei Huang and Brittany M. White. Their work appears in journals such as Tetrahedron Letters, Organic & Biomolecular Chemistry, Nature Methods,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Organic Letters.
